
Where should you take your date this Valentines Day?!
Valentine's Day is right around the corner, which means it's time to start making plans! Here are five of the best places in Cochise County to take your date!

5.) Entertainment
Going to the movies may seem like a stereotypical place to take a date, but Cinemark has a variety of movies for every couple set to play on the 14th. Wuthering Heights, I Can Only Imagine 2, and Crime 101 are a few of the movies you can buy tickets for that day.
The Sierra Vista Community Theatre also has a showing of Meteor Shower by Steve Martin Valentines Day weekend. This is a live performance and a romantic comedy perfect for a date night.
4.) La Casita
La Casita is a well-known local restaurant in Sierra Vista with great service and delicious Mexican Food. Despite the recent fire in their banquet room, La Casita is still open for business!
With delicious food options and an atmosphere that screams love, La Casita could be a great place to go this Valentine's Day. Whenever I go here, I get myself a big old sopapilla sundae, but they also have appetizers and entree options if that's more to your palate.

3.) Visit the Sierra Vista Animal Shelter
If you don't have a date, or have a date who loves animals, The Nancy J. Brua Animal Care Center is having their 18th anniversary event on Valentine's Day! If you or your partner want to cuddle up with some animals, visit the animal shelter from 12-4 pm.
The event will consist of activities such as special adoptions, a rummage sale, refreshments, a kissing booth, and free adoptions for some of their pets. Even if you plan to go to dinner or a show, stopping by the animal shelter is a great activity to add to your list.
2.) A Picnic at Carr Canyon
I know what you're thinking- A picnic? Outside? In the middle of February?! Despite Arizona not being known for its cold weather, February will sometimes have icy days. But if the weather allows it, a picnic at Carr Canyon can be a creative, dazzling place to take a date. This is especially true in the winter when there is a chance of snow on the mountain tops.
There are picnic tables available at the base of the trail, so all you really need to do is bring some food. And let's be honest, taking the time to put together food for a picnic with your Valentine is a thoughtful and sweet way to show you care.
On top of all of that, if you decide you want to walk off all the food you ate, a nice stroll in nature is a romantic way to spend your afternoon or evening.
1.) The Copper Pig, Bisbee Arizona
The Copper Pig in Bisbee is at the top of my list due to its atmosphere and wonderful menu. They have appetizers and entrees such as Jambalaya, Pig Chowder, and Shrimp Gambas.
Not only does this restaurant offer great food that differs from the other options in the area, but they also have a 4.8/5-star rating on Yelp. With a great reputation and admirable dishes, The Copper Pig is definitely where I am going on Valentine's Day.
They take reservations, so if you are thinking of taking your valentine here, give them a call and reserve a table.
